How much do ust j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 27, 2026, the average yearly pay for ust in the United States is $72,499.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$68,500.00 and $76,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

We’re Hiring! Join the UST Environmental Contractor Team 

We’re growing and looking for skilled, motivated professionals to join our crew! UST Environmental Contractor is currently hiring for the following positions:

Experienced Roll-Off Truck Driver

  • CDL Class A or B required
  • Must have a clean driving record and experience operating roll-off trucks
  • Knowledge of DOT regulations and safe loading practices a must

Equipment Operator / Foreman

  • Experience with excavators, backhoes, and skid steers
  • Ability to lead a small crew on environmental and construction projects
  • Strong communication and planning skills

Environmental Technician

  • Fieldwork experience preferred (tank cleaning, sampling, site work)
  • Must be dependable, safety-focused, and willing to learn
  • HAZWOPER certification a plus (or willingness to obtain)
